>> maybe you have another sqlite3 lib in your system which hides the one
>> shipped with osgeo4w.
>>
>> Try to remove the sqlite3 lib from the osgeo4w installation and then run
>> QGis again. If the error persists then it's using a wrong sqlite3 lib.
